Web(a) In addition to the service of a summons and complaint in an action for unlawful … WebOption: Prejudgment Claim of Right to Possession. CP10.5: A landlord can have the sheriff or process server deliver this with the Complaint and Summons. It lets any unknown adults who live in the rental unit know about the eviction and their right to join the case. Proof of Service of Summons: POS-010

WebService of the Prejudgment Claim MUST be served by a marshal, sheriff, or registered process server only. A private party cannot serve the Prejudgment claim. When proper service of the Prejudgment Claim is done, ensure the following boxes are checked: #5 on the Judgment for Possession and #24a.(1.) on the Writ of Possession
